Output 1daf108587e7873411942efb13fdec9e6d7792dcd0d375cf8e150ffb1dc60e3a:4

value
2712305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a96b1d6971b834f4e924f0869d2ad8743841f2 OP_EQUAL
address
3BxiZRhwA2GvqBXGsWnN5bW7iTExUh82H4
transaction
1daf108587e7873411942efb13fdec9e6d7792dcd0d375cf8e150ffb1dc60e3a
confirmations
413525
spent
true